Abstract

This research aimed to analyze qualitatively the performance of Village Fund execute at Dore Village Bima Regency. it is undeniable that most villages in Indonesia make village head elections in a family manner, regardless of their abilities or competencies that greatly affect their performance, as also applies in the village of Dore, Palibelo District, Bima Regency. In this study, researchers focused on the performance of village officials, not just the village head. This study used a qualitative approach, retrieval and collection of data using observation, interview, and documentation techniques to the informant as much as five (5) persons within the Performance Analysis Management of Village Fund at Dore Village Bima Regency. The research result showed that the Performance Analysis Management of Village Fund at Dore Village Bima Regency had not yet run well as from 5 (five) dimention investigated, 4(four) dimensions did not work well such as dimension of responsibility, service quality, productivity and accountability but one was only that worked well enough is responsiveness. Based on these findings, improvements such as training or courses are recommended for village officials and the provision of media as a tool to account for the management of village funds so that the performance of the Dore Village government is expected to be more optimal than before.
